Philosophy's greatest luminaries brought down to earth.

Nietzsche Within Your Grasp offers fast, easy access to the life and works of one of history's most influential, iconoclastic philosophers. In fewer than 100 pages, you'll get all the essentials in everyday language. A short biographical sketch sets the scene, followed by chapters illuminating Nietzsche's overall philosophy and his most important writings.

For students and lifelong learners seeking a point of entry into Nietzsche's radical pronouncements and often puzzling aphorisms, Nietzsche Within Your Grasp is the springboard to enriched understanding.

Inside you'll find all the vital details, including:

Life
* Family and upbringing
* Influences including Schopenhauer and Wagner
* Descent into madness
* Exploitation of writings by fascist groups


Philosophy
* Overview of key works, themes, and impact
* Aphorisms, essays, and autobiography
* Individual chapters on The Birth of Tragedy, The Gay Science, Thus Spoke Zarathustra, Beyond Good and Evil, and Ecce Homo


Additional Resources
* Tracking down Nietzsche's major works
* Collections, biographies, and critical writings
* Nietzsche on the Internet
